PowerSecure Adds $10 Million In New Business

PowerSecure International, (NYSE: POWR) today announced it has been awarded approximately $8 million of new distributed generation (DG) business and approximately $2 million of new utility infrastructure (UI) business.

The $8 million in new DG business awards include approximately $3 million of new data center business, primarily for turnkey electrical infrastructure design, implementation and commissioning at a single customer site, a new $4 million DG project for a global sporting goods manufacturer and $1 million in new company-owned DG projects.

The $2 million in new UI business awards include a variety of new transmission and distribution projects for existing utility customers.
